Wisconsin's climate is characterized by harsh winters with heavy snow and ice, and warm, humid summers. These extremes put significant stress on RV roof sealants, making them prone to cracking, peeling, and eventual leaks. Proactive RV roof sealant is critical for preventing water damage.
When seeking RV roof sealant in Wisconsin, prioritize providers who understand the impact of prolonged freeze-thaw cycles. Proper application ensures the sealant remains flexible and intact through severe temperature fluctuations. Wisconsin's harsh winters with snow, ice, and extreme cold can cause standard sealants to become brittle and crack. This creates openings for water intrusion. We use specialized sealants designed to remain flexible and durable in extreme cold.
